搜索
查看: 644|回复: 9
打印 上一主题 下一主题

??!

[复制链接]
跳转到指定楼层
楼主
发表于 2016-8-25 20:18:19 | 只看该作者 |只看大图 回帖奖励 |倒序浏览 |阅读模式
10啊哈币
????????

QQ图片20160825202625.png (97.06 KB, 下载次数: 2)

QQ图片20160825202625.png
沙发
发表于 2016-8-25 21:32:57 | 只看该作者
掉了个分号         
板凳
发表于 2016-8-26 13:48:37 | 只看该作者
楼上说的不太详细   
地板
发表于 2016-8-26 13:54:08 | 只看该作者
#include <stdio.h>
int main()
{
    printf("嘻嘻!")          //对了,系统判定有printf("文字+标点")这样的语句
    system("pause");     //错了,系统判定system和printf不是连在一起的
    return 0;                  //这行没有错
}                                  //这行没有错
5#
发表于 2016-8-27 11:01:58 | 只看该作者
printf那行没有用;表示结束      加上就行   
6#
发表于 2016-8-29 19:49:44 | 只看该作者
此处末端加个英文的分号,即;

4GK7LW1[LBX9OGBW12`1B5H.png (6.8 KB, 下载次数: 5)

.

.
7#
发表于 2016-8-29 19:56:03 | 只看该作者

其实应该是这样的
编译器从头到尾扫描
扫描到printf("什么什么的")之后,编译器认为这是一个表达式,包含一个函数调用,往下寻找运算符(加减乘除之类的),或者是分号。可是编译器找到了system,就报错。因为编译器默认会跳过空格,看到system的时候已经到了system一行,所以编译器在system那一行报错的
我是这么理解的
8#
发表于 2016-8-30 16:09:55 | 只看该作者
分号
9#
发表于 2016-8-31 16:52:37 | 只看该作者
printf("脑袋里进咸鱼的\n袜子");    看到这个分号没!区别出来了,这是一条语句,和人说话一样,说完一句话结尾要有句号(。),那么计算机在执行一条语句,等到语句“说”完之后要加分号(;)!望采纳!
10#
发表于 2016-10-22 18:47:12 | 只看该作者
printf("脑袋里进咸鱼的\n袜子")后要加;
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

广播台
特别关注
快速回复 返回顶部 返回列表